BLACK INK: AFRICAN AMERICAN BOOK FESTIVAL

Hosted by Charleston Friends of the Library, this fest supports local African American writers and aims to expose a broader audience of readers to their work. Hoping to surpass last year’s numbers—50 authors and more than 500 attendees—this year’s event has even more in store. Keynote speakers are celebrated novelist Terry McMillan and Newberry Award-winning author Kwame Alexander (above). Charleston County Public Library, 68 Calhoun St. Saturday, 11am. $65 for keynotes; free for other events.
